Quality Assurance Administrator
Kimball Midwest, a national distributor of maintenance, repair, and operation products, is searching for a Quality Assurance Administrator for our Columbus, Ohio Corporate Office location.
As a Kimball Midwest associate, you'll be part of a company built on long-term growth and strong values. From $1 million in sales in 1983 to over $500 million today, our success has been driven by our people. Despite our growth, we have stayed true to our family-owned and operated roots—where employees are recognized as individuals and our culture remains a top priority.
Responsibilities- Works with the Quality Assurance Specialists, QA Engineer, QA Manager, and QA Assistant Manager to bring product quality issues to resolution
- Manages incoming product concerns from the sales force and documents issues using Cases.
- Answers Tier 2 Contact Center Escalated phone calls while logged into the Quality Assurance Hunt Group
- Responds to emails sent to the Quality Assurance Group
- Manages the creation and sending out of UPS return labels
- Manages the placing of No Charge replacement orders and credit requests
- Manages the sales rep experience timeline (time to close a case). Manages communications associated with the stock check process.
- Assists the Quality Assurance team in ensuring timely and accurate repairs
- Assists the Quality Assurance team in ensuring that electronic files are maintained for all vendors. This includes Certificates of Compliance, Material Test Reports, and updated warranty information
- Continually learns about Kimball Midwest products and quality procedures
- Assists the Quality Assurance department with completing continuous improvement goals, as applicable to this position
- Assumes any special responsibilities assigned by the QA Manager, QA Assistant Manager, or Director of Purchasing
- 2-3 years of Customer Service experience
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ications (Excel, Word, Outlook)
- Strong communication skills in both written and verbal form
- Ability to type quickly and accurately
